Summary
The bill establishes the South Carolina Headquarters Relocation and Growth Fund, a separate trust that provides grants to businesses that locate or expand corporate, regional, divisional, or shared‑service headquarters in the state. To qualify, projects must create at least 50 jobs, pay wages double the county average, invest $10 million, and sign a performance agreement with clawback provisions. The measure aims to attract high‑pay, high‑investment employers and boost local economies.
